Abstract

Natural Zeolite is an inorganic mineral rock that is widely found in Indonesia.
Natural zeolite is a porous substance with good physicochemical properties, such
as high cation exchange capacity, cation selectivity, large pore volume,
adsorption of other compounds, and good catalysts. In this research the natural
zeolite are utilized to increase the productivity of farmland where natural zeolite
is able to improve soil ability in the screaming and binding nutrients given
through fertilizer. In this experiment the natural zeolite must go through the
activation process with the addition of NaCl active solution with ultrasonic
waves-assisted (sonication) to reduce the high levels of impurities that cover the
active sites of the natural zeolite. The observation variable used is power
ultrasound homogenizer, activation time and also concentration of the NaCl
active solution. The results of natural zeolite activation are then evaluated using
KTK, Iod number (surface area), capacity of adsorption, XRF, SEM and FTIR.
The value of KTK and number of Iod obtained at the Power ultrasound
homogenizer of 50% is 280.679 meq/100gram zeolite and 216.611 mg I2/gram
zeolite. The value of KTK and number of Iod is obtained at the activation time
of 50 minutes is 222.94 meq/100gram zeolite and 186.362 mg I2/gram zeolite.
The value of KTK and number of Iod obtained at a concentration of NaCl 0.5 N
is 227.59 meq/100gram zeolite and 198.461 mg I2/gram zeolite. Meanwhile, for
the optimal capacity of adsorption (Qkap) is 158.80 mg urea/gram zeolite,
namely in the concentration of NaCl 0.5 N. XRF characterization obtained Si/Al
ratio of natural zeolite is 5.16, activated of natural zeolite (power ultrasound) is
5.31, activated of natural zeolite (activation time) is 5.41 and activated of natural
zeolite (concentrations of NaCl) is 5.30. Meanwhile, the characterization of
SEM and FTIR is to find out the morphology of surfaces and the functional
groups of natural zeolite, activated zeolite and urea intercalated of active zeolite.
